This is an excellent opportunity for an ambitious Real estate investment analyst with experience of mezzanine lending to join this growing investment firm. Working closely with the partners you will have a key role to play and will be heavily involved in all stages of the Investment process.
The company specialises in lending to UK-based SME developers and have a separate fund for acquiring income producing assets which you will also be involved with.
Mezzanine is a niche area of the lending industry with huge potential for growth. This is an exciting time for the company who is looking to expand, having established themselves in the space with over £2bn so far in completed deals.
Responsibilities:
* Contribute to the execution of mezzanine lending transactions in the SME development space
* Support the Partners with due diligence for potential deals, and nurture relationships with existing and new development partners
* Design, amend and update models (ranging in complexity) for transactions and other business needs; run scenarios on the models and produce outputs for external and internal purposes
* Creation of transaction models based on standard templates
* Perform sensitivity and scenario analysis
* Perform formula and analytical review on the integrity of internal models
* Qualitative and Quantitative deal analysis and ad-hoc modelling
* Research and analyse new business opportunities and produce clear summaries to enable decision-making
* Production of clear and articulate marketing material such as teasers, presentations, and credit papers. This will include elements of research and information collation
